While visiting my mother she showed me and my family a game, it was Penny Drop. She didn't have an actual board we played on a cardboard box that she made, but we had hours of fun. I told her I can make you something better, so I made this is six-sided box to play on its a little cleaner and holds all her pennies and dice.   RULES: The rules are simple I added them to the bottom of the box but here they are if you need them.  The goal is to get rid of your pennies. Roll the Dice and if you land on 1-5 you place your penny on that number. If the numbered slot has a coin already there you must take that coin. If you roll a 6 on the dice, you get rid of that coin by “dropping” it into the 6 slot/hole. The first person with 0 coins wins.   I Added photos on how to customize the text on the top. You need bambu studios on PC open the file for the lid w numbers and on the left side panel you will see a drop down for PROCESS. In that drop down you will see 2 tabs one say global one says objects. Click the objects tab and you will see all the Text that says Drop and Penny. You can right click and hit edit text a box will pop up on the right hand side. There is a box that says input text you can delete the  word penny and put what you want. below that box there is FONT you can change the font aswell. Everything else I would leave as is. once you are done there is a symbol "Ta" hit that and you will exit the editing for the writing. Once you are satisfied you can hit slice on the top right, then hit print.      For the design I went with a Hexagon shape and added slots to hold your pennies. I added the writing to the top and put the game rules on the bottom of the box. I made the slots large enough to fit a Penny, Nickel or Dime.
